User Experience (UX) Best Practices for Website Design
Creating a website that is both visually appealing and functional requires careful consideration of user experience principles. By adhering to best practices in UX design, you can ensure your website is easy to navigate, engaging to use, and ultimately successful in achieving its goals. Focus on clear and concise content that is easily scannable, utilize a logical site structure with intuitive navigation menus, and, make sure the overall design is consistent and aesthetically pleasing.
- Utilize responsive design to ensure optimal viewing across various devices.
- Carry out user testing throughout the design process to gather valuable feedback.
- Improve website speed and performance for a smooth user experience.
Keep in mind that UX is an ongoing process. Continuously analyze user behavior, collect feedback, and make iterative improvements to refine your website and enhance the user experience over time.
Building From Concept to Creation: The Website Design Process
Designing a website is a process that involves numerous phases. It all begins with a clear idea - what purpose will the website serve? Who is the target audience? Once these fundamental questions are resolved, the design process can truly commence.
The first stage typically involves researching similar websites and identifying trends. This helps to shape the overall aesthetic. Next, wireframing is used to outline the website's layout and flow.
Once the foundation is in place, designers can begin creating the visual elements. This includes selecting colors, typography, and images.
Throughout the process, it's essential to collaborate closely with the client to ensure that the final product meets their expectations.
Adaptive Web Design Ensuring Seamless Experiences Across Devices
In today's dynamic digital landscape, users navigate the web via a myriad of devices, ranging from traditional desktops to sleek smartphones and versatile tablets. To address this diverse user base, responsive web design has emerged as an essential strategy for delivering seamless and optimized experiences across all platforms. This approach involves employing flexible layouts, fluid grids, and media-specific stylesheets to ensure that websites resize seamlessly to the screen size and resolution of each device.
By implementing responsive design principles, developers can construct websites that showcase flawlessly on any device, improving user satisfaction and driving engagement.
